What is Polyurethane?
Polyurethane is a type of plastic that has been in use for many years. It is a versatile material that is used in many different applications, including furniture, insulation, and even bird baths. Polyurethane is a type of urethane polymer, which is a combination of two or more different types of molecules. This combination of molecules gives polyurethane its unique properties, such as its ability to be molded and shaped into different forms. It is also highly resistant to water, making it a great choice for outdoor applications.
The Pros and Cons of Polyurethane Bird Baths
Polyurethane bird baths offer a variety of advantages. They are lightweight, relatively inexpensive, and can be molded into a variety of shapes and sizes. In addition, polyurethane is highly resistant to water, making it a great choice for outdoor applications.
However, there are also some potential risks associated with polyurethane bird baths. Some polyurethane products may contain toxic additives or chemicals that can be harmful to birds. In addition, polyurethane can be prone to cracking and breaking if it is exposed to extreme temperatures. Finally, polyurethane bird baths can be difficult to clean and maintain, since the material is not porous and can be hard to scrub.
